Our ceilidh band was formed in response to the need for Scots-away-from-home to have a decent party without having to return to the ‘homeland’. As the popularity of ceilidhs has increased, the group have played for weddings, birthday parties, corporate events, Burns Night Celebrations and Charity Balls. The band comes complete with an excellent caller, who will liaise with you before the event, to plan dances at a suitable level for your guests. He will lead your guests – from beginners to seasoned dancers, through a wide variety of well known dances. The band is available as a three or four piece with caller; instruments include: the accordion, violin, guitar and bass.
